Sleep Paralysis: A Terrifying Truth



Have you ever felt utterly trapped in your own bed, unable to speak? That's sleep paralysis, a terrifying state where your mind gathers consciousness before your body does. During this unsettling episode, you might sense an oppressive pressure on your chest, a suffocating sensation in the room, and even visions. These terrifying sights can be so intense that they leave you shaken long after the episode has passed.


While sleep paralysis is usually brief, it can be a deeply frightening experience that leaves you with lasting fear. Learning about the causes of sleep paralysis, such as stress, lack of sleep, or certain medical conditions, can help ease your fears and provide you with tools to deal with these episodes.
